HANDOVER — Backup tapes, off-site rotation

From Bren to dispatch desk.

Twelve tapes, set K, sealed in the grey transit case. Destination: Coldvault facility, Ashmere. Pickup window 14:00–15:00 today. Case stays locked; key travels separately with me. Log the seal number on departure and flag any tamper marks immediately. Return set J comes back on the same run — check it in before the tapes leave your sight. Do not combine with other shipments. Courier handover is governed by the line below.

courier memo of yahif-faweg: the quenael tamius courier leaves the prawyn jorix kaswyn istox silmir brieth zormir fenvan ledger at gate 3145 under passcode 231062

Subject: Proposed Outsourcing of Tier-1 Support to Hollowbrook Services

Dear Executive Team,

Following our review of support costs for the Quartzline platform, we propose transferring tier-1 ticket handling to Hollowbrook Services, with onboarding phased over two quarters. Finance should note the projected 18% reduction in per-ticket cost, offset partly by transition fees. Full figures are attached for scrutiny. The strategic rationale behind the timing is summarized below.

internal memo for hafog-hadug: The pricing group signed off on a budget of $16.1 million for Project Gorir. The renewal with Oliionax Systems closes at $14.1 million a year, 46 percent above the last contract.

Ticket: Nightjar digest emails firing at the wrong hour

So the batch digest scheduler treats user timezones as UTC offsets captured at signup, which breaks every DST change. Folks in Westmere got their "morning" digest at 3am. Fix should store zone names, not offsets. First reported against the build below.

trace token, kahog-tajeg: htk6_97d963

## Changelog — Font vendoring defaults changed

As of this release, the Bracken UI build no longer fetches third-party fonts at build time. All typefaces used by the Lanternwell suite are now vendored into the repo under a dedicated assets directory, and the fetch step is skipped by default. If you're onboarding, nothing to install — the fonts travel with the checkout. The build flags controlling this behavior are listed below.

settings of hadup-yafog:
LAMAEL_PIN=3761
LAMAEL_TENANT=istmir
LAMAEL_METRICS_HOST=metrics.lamael.plorvasys.test
LAMAEL_SEAL=seal_8ea68500
LAMAEL_STANDBY_TEAM=fraok